Landslides block roads in Rasuwa

Multiple landslides triggered by heavy rains have blocked Kalikasthan-Rasuwagadhi road section in Rasuwa district.
Vehicular movement through Rasuwagadhi customs came to a halt on Tuesday after two massive landslides blocked the two-kilometre Timure-Rasuwagadhi stretch. Twenty-five containers parked near the customs office were also damaged in the landslides. The containers were preparing to leave for Kerung in China to ferry goods.
Nearly two dozen containers loaded with goods have been stranded near Nepal-China border because of landslides.
Deputy Superintendent of Police Abadesh Bista said the local administration has asked the Chinese security personnel to divert the Nepal-bound containers to safe location after the landslide-caused traffic obstructions.
DSP Bista added reopening the road could take more than 30 hours as they lack equipment.
A dozer belonging to Road Division Office is trapped in Mulkharka area after a landslide. Chief District Officer Krishna Prasad Adhikari said Nepal Army and Nepal Police personnel have been mobilised in the landslide-hit areas to clear the debris.
Meanwhile, mudslides have blocked the road at Ramche, Gaun and Mulkharka areas in the district. Police said continuous mudslides have hindered their efforts to resume traffic.
